Positive trends in global education access are expected to decrease dementia prevalence worldwide by 6.2 million cases by the year 2050. Meanwhile, anticipated trends in smoking, high body mass index and high blood sugar are predicted to increase prevalence by nearly the same number: 6.8 million cases.

The devastating bushfires in Australia had a larger impact on the world's 2020 climate than the pandemic-related lockdowns, as plumes of smoke cooled global temperatures and pushed tropical thunderstorms northward. New research indicates that regional wildfires can have far-reaching climatic effects that are comparable to a major volcanic eruption.
